We Wally's Widget Warehouse takes orders from 7 A.M. to 7 P.M. The manager wants to analyze the process and has provided the following process flow diagram. There are three steps required to ship a customer order. The first step is to take the order from a customer . The second step is to pick the order for the customer and then they have to pack the order to ready it for shipping. The order-taking step works at a maximum rate of 90 customer orders per hour. Order picking works at a maximum of 75 per hour, and packing works at 50 per hour.
